Lucky - Neo Western
Meditative western about an aging loner facing mortality in a small desert town.

Lucky, a 90-year-old man living in a small desert town, faces the reality of aging and his own impending death. A veteran of the Second World War and an atheist, he spends his days meditating, drinking, and contemplating life with a dry sense of humor. When Lucky suffers a health scare, he begins to reflect on his life, relationships, and mortality. The film is a poignant exploration of the wisdom that comes with age, the inevitability of death, and the beauty of human connection.
